o ver breed |ˌōvərˈbrēd ˌoʊvərˈbrid | ▶verb ( past and past participle overbred ) breed or cause to breed to excess: the husband and wife were forcing the female dogs to overbreed, and litters grew up with several health problems.
over |breed |əʊvəˈbriːd | ▶verb ( past and past participle overbred ) breed or cause to breed to excess: (as adj. overbred ) : the cats are overbred and their immune system is too weak to fight infections.
